Search goes on for that elusive win

The Magpies traveled west to St Clears hopeful of emulating their recent National Plate win against the same opposition but suffered the disappointment of a 32-19 defeat. Tumble started the game well and were unlucky not to take the lead after five minutes when the ball was lost over the line in the act of scoring; back came the Saints and ten minutes later after a low drive they were awarded a try when the referee deemed that the ball had been grounded, the conversion was missed. Five minutes later St Clears were 12-0 ahead when their flanker broke from 20 yards out to score a converted try. This score seemed to bring the Magpies to life and they were soon back on level terms through tries from Number 8 Steffan Davies and second row Nathan Willard. Captain and outside half Steven Hewitt converting the latter to make the score 12-12. On the stroke of half time the referee awarded a penalty to the Saints after Tumble were penalised for being off-side in front of the posts. The kick was landed and St Clears went into the break 15-12 ahead.

The second half started with St Clears excerpting pressure on the Magpies and they were deep in Tumble territory when full back Scott Jones intercepted 5 yards out to run the length of the field for a try which was converted by Hewitt. St Clears now upped the pressure and brought out mistakes in the Magpies' play. Two tries were score by St Clears to take them into a 25-19 lead before a late converted try saw them win the game 32-19 and deny Tumble even a losing bonus point. It was evident from today's game that this young side needs the confidence that would be gained from getting that first win. It's a fine line between winning and losing but the lift from that first win would make all the difference.
